verb
-
(transitive)To remove a star from.
“If you want to unstar the review request, just click on the star icon again.”
- (UK, transitive)To demote a question from an oral one to a written one (because oral questions are conventionally marked with a star on the Order of Business in the House of Commons).
Definitions from Wiktionary, CC BY-SA.
Etymology
From un- + star.
